  • Patent number: 4562353
    Abstract: A method and device for producing nuclear images of an object under investigation which emits nuclear radiation, wherein the object is scanned along a scan axis by means of a radiation detector having a radiation detector field of view. The radiation detector field of view is masked by means of a mask field of view which partially exceeds the radiation detector field of view along the scan axis. The loss of sensitivity perpendicular to the scan axis in the parts of the mask field of view which exceed the radiation detector field of view is compensated by applying a weighting function proportional to the inverse of the incremental area along the scan axis bounded by the radiation detector field of view.

  • Patent number: 4316257
    Abstract: A method and apparatus for the dynamic modification of the spatial distortion correction capabilities of a scintillation camera having spatial distortion correction apparatus. The spatial distortion correction apparatus includes a memory having stored therein spatial distortion correction factors in a predetermined addressable format. During the on-line use of the scintillation camera, the spatial distortion correction apparatus transforms the image event coordinate position data from the scintillation camera in accordance with the stored distortion correction factors to provide corrected image event coordinate repositioning data. The spatial distortion correction modification apparatus and method provides modification of the corrected image event coordinate data in accordance with the respective energy levels of the image events to provide accurate spatial distortion correction characteristics for the actual energy levels of the image events.

  • Patent number: 4020348
    Abstract: A scintillation camera is suspended from an elevated gantry and is laterally movable. Sensors detecting the lateral position of the scintillation camera detector head produce signals which are combined with the detector head output signals to produce an image reflecting the occurrence of radioactive events within an expanded rectilinear field of view of the detector head. This image is stored using a recording medium.
